Needs Assessment – Centennial’s Plan for Student Assessment

Assessment Tools

  1. DIBELS (Dynamic Indicators of Basic Early Literacy Skills)—assessment system designed to assess student progress in kindergarten thru fifth grade.  The DIBELS assesses phonological awareness, alphabetic principle, and fluency with connected text.  Each student will be assessed at the beginning (August), middle (January) and end of the year (May) to allow for timely instructional feedback.  Students determined to be “at risk” will receive progress monitoring by the classroom teacher every 2 weeks.  Students determined to be at “some risk” will receive monthly progress monitoring by the classroom teacher.  Progress monitoring scores will be submitted to the literacy coaches.

  2. Developmental Spelling Analysis (DSA) –includes screening inventory to determine developmental stage of spelling development and two feature inventories that determine particular instructional needs of students.  Grades 1-5 will administer 2 times per year, August & January.  Kindergarten may administer in January and then again in May to students determined to be ready. (Kindergarten inventory portion)

  3. Rigby Benchmark Assessment—an individual reading inventory that assesses fluency and comprehension through running records, questioning, and retelling.  Initial assessment will place students in appropriate instructional level text for direct instruction in reading.  Students will be assessed with a benchmark assessment each time they move to a new level of text.  Students need an accuracy rate of 90% or above, score at least 75-80% on the comprehension check, and meet the fluency goals for each level before moving on to the next level.

Types of Assessments

 

Screening Tests—quick assessments designed to alert teachers to the presence of a problem in a specific area.  They allow the teacher to separate a group of children who need additional help from the ones who do not.  The DIBELS is an example of a screening assessment.

 

Diagnostic Tests—these measures are designed to identify specific instructional needs.  They are usually administered after a problem has been identified.  The Ganske DSA is an example of a diagnostic test.  Example:  The DIBELS screening would first identify the presence of a problem with decoding, and the DSA could then provide detailed information about the decoding problem, such as a problem with short vowels.  This then allows the teacher to plan effective instruction to address the problem. The Scholastic Reading Inventory can be used as a diagnostic test to pinpoint problems with comprehension.

 

Progress-Monitoring Tests—these measures are designed to monitor the student’s progress from time to time in order to determine whether instruction is having the desired effect.  Progress monitoring tests are quick measures designed to be given periodically with little disruption to classroom instruction.  In addition to the DIBELS Progress Monitoring tests, running records and anecdotal notes are also examples of progress monitoring informal assessments.

 

Outcome Tests—these measures are indicators of long-term growth.  Outcome tests include the ITBS and the CRCT.  The Scholastic Reading Inventory is also an example of an outcome test.  When used to gauge trends in achievement from fall to spring, the DIBELS measure is also an outcome test. 

 

When used together, the system of screening, diagnostic, and progress-monitoring assessments help ensure that instruction targets children’s needs.  This type of instructional planning is sometimes described as “data-driven.”
